Nokia has decided to finally call it quits with its unsuccessful Ovi Files service. Ovi Files was created to allow users to remotely access photos, music and documents that were stored on their home computer. It also allowed you to browse, search and view photos, automatically resized for your mobile phone. Through the acquisition of Avvenu Incorporated in December 2007, Nokia originally aimed to release Ovi Files as a premium service. However due to poor uptake, in July 2007 Nokia decided to allow users to take advantage of this service free of charge. It appears as though the service is still underused, and so Nokia will officially discontinue the service as of 1 October 2010. Check out the email confirmation of this news after the break.

Nokia Completes Acquisition Of Motally Incby Ibrahim Jogee | Industry, Mobile Phones, News, Press, Services, SoftwareEarlier last month, Nokia announced its plans to acquire Motally Inc., a mobile analytics service enables developers and publishers to optimize the development of their mobile applications through increased understanding of how users engage. Today Nokia confirmed that it has completed this acquisition. The service offering is planned to be adapted for Qt, Symbian, MeeGo and Java developers.

Nokia X3 Touch & Type Unveiled | Touch Debuted On S40by Ibrahim Jogee | Handset, Mobile Phones, News, PressNokia today unveiled the super slim Nokia X3 (X3-02) Touch and Type, with a unique combination of a touch screen and traditional 12 button phone keypad. As Nokia’s first ‘Touch and Type’ phone, the Nokia X3 allows people to tap quickly on the touch screen, as well as enjoy the familiarity of the full keypad for quick fire text messaging and phone calls. In selected markets, the X3 Touch and Type will also be offered with Ovi Music Unlimited, allowing access to a library of over 11 million tracks.
